What Are Bicycle Tires?
Bicycle tires are the rubber coverings that fit around the outer rim of your bike wheels. They provide grip, cushioning, and support as you ride your bike. Bicycle tires come in different sizes, styles, and tread patterns to suit different types of riding.
What Are Bicycle Tubes?
Bicycle tubes are the inflatable rubber tubes that sit inside the bicycle tire. They hold the air that gives the tire its shape and cushioning. Bicycle tubes come in different sizes to match the size of the tire they are intended to fit.
Why Do You Need To Replace Bicycle Tires And Tubes?
Bicycle tires and tubes can wear out over time due to punctures, cracks, or general wear and tear. As a result, they can lose their grip, stability, and comfort. It is important to replace them when they start to show signs of wear and tear to ensure your safety and riding experience.

Types Of Bicycle Tires And Tubes 26 Inch
There are several types of bicycle tires and tubes 26 inch that you can choose from. These include:
- Mountain bike tires and tubes
- Road bike tires and tubes
- Cyclocross bike tires and tubes
- Hybrid bike tires and tubes
Mountain Bike Tires And Tubes 26 Inch
Mountain bike tires and tubes 26 inch are designed for off-road riding on rough terrain. They have a knobby tread pattern that provides excellent traction and grip on loose dirt, rocks, and mud. They also have thick sidewalls that can resist punctures and abrasions.
Road Bike Tires And Tubes 26 Inch
Road bike tires and tubes 26 inch are designed for high-speed riding on smooth pavement. They have a smooth or slick tread pattern that reduces rolling resistance, which allows you to go faster with less effort. They also have thin sidewalls that make them lightweight but vulnerable to punctures.
Cyclocross Bike Tires And Tubes 26 Inch
Cyclocross bike tires and tubes 26 inch are designed for racing and riding on mixed terrain, including grass, mud, gravel, and pavement. They have a semi-knobby tread pattern that provides good traction on loose and uneven surfaces. They also have thicker sidewalls than road bike tires to resist punctures.
Hybrid Bike Tires And Tubes 26 Inch
Hybrid bike tires and tubes 26 inch are designed for versatile riding on a variety of surfaces, including pavement, gravel, and light trails. They have a tread pattern that provides good traction and stability on different terrains. They also have thicker sidewalls than road bike tires to resist punctures.
